I think you already understood what we meant. I was also thinking the exact same thing you wrote - it must be weird for you to think of watermelon as a seasonal fruit, after all it's available a lot longer where you live than in Europe. Such fruits like melons, watermelons, peaches, strawberries, cherries, any kind of berries are here considered as summer fruits and they are usually more fresh and less artificially grown than the ones we have in stores during winter. So they are also more healthy and taste better :) Oranges, lemons and bananas,apples are for me a wintertime fruits, always had them mostly in winter.

Last week I was invited to "Wickelklöße" - rolled dumplings. That's a specialty from certain places in Saxony. I had helped an old guy from my astronomer's society with his computer a couple of times, and as a thanks he made those for me. It's from his birthplace and he enjoys these dumplings a lot, but for some reason his own kids and grandkids never let him make them.

Stupid kids and grandkids! Those dumplings were very yummy; very hearty from the pan-fried breadcrumbs that are rolled into the potato dough! :wOOt:
